Desire for remarriage and 'KANK' influenced a man to shoot his wife



Indian people love movies, love the characters of movies and they admire them at very large extent. Most of the times, they live and try to act according to the film stars.



A man in Mumbai forced his wife to watch the movie ‘Kabhi Alvida Na Kahna‘ based on extra marital affairs and chacters in this film do find their love outside marriage.



The man wanted that his wife would allow him to marry again with his girlfriend. His wife refused and he shot her after that.



According to the Mumbai Mirror daily, his wife was not staying with him. She was living with her two children after a marital spat.



The newspaper said the 32-year-old man’s real intention in taking his wife to the movie was to persuade her to allow him to marry.



Later, his wife survived after treatment and gave statement against her husband.



According to the film’s director Karan Johar,

I was shocked when hear about this incident. I never had thought the subject of this movie would incite such strong emotions in the people.
